热门手游

网站打开速度慢怎么优化

  • 分类: Mac软件
  • 大小: 682.36MB
  • 支持: 28377
  • 发布:
  • 人气: 226
  • 评论: 139
安卓下载

应用截图

网站打开速度慢怎么优化游戏界面截图1
网站打开速度慢怎么优化核心玩法截图2
网站打开速度慢怎么优化角色详情截图3

应用介绍

网站打开速度是影响用户体验和搜索引擎排名的关键因素。一个加载缓慢的网站不仅会令访客迅速离开,还会在搜索引擎的排名算法中处于不利地位。本文将系统性地解析网站速度慢的根源,并提供一套从诊断到治疗的完整优化方案,帮助您有效提升网站性能。

一、诊断:找出网站速度慢的根源

在着手优化之前,首先需要明确问题所在。网站速度慢通常由以下几个核心原因导致:

  • 服务器性能不足:当服务器配置过低或资源紧张时,无法高效处理并发请求,导致响应延迟。
  • 资源文件过大:未经优化的高清图片、视频以及冗长的代码文件是拖慢加载速度的主要元凶。
  • 网络传输问题:包括服务器带宽不足、未使用内容分发网络(CDN)导致用户访问路径过远等。
  • 前端代码与结构缺陷:如过多的HTTP请求、未压缩的代码、渲染阻塞资源以及复杂的DOM结构。

可以使用浏览器自带的开发者工具(按F12键)进行初步诊断,在“网络”(Network)面板中查看各资源的加载时间瀑布图,识别加载最慢的文件。

二、优化:全方位提升网站加载速度

1. 优化图片与媒体资源

图片通常是网页中体积最大的部分。优化策略包括:

  • 格式与压缩:将图片转换为WebP或AVIF等现代格式,并使用工具压缩体积,在质量与大小间取得平衡。
  • 尺寸适配:根据实际显示尺寸提供图片,避免上传3000像素大图却只显示为300像素。
  • 懒加载技术:使用loading="lazy"属性,让图片仅在进入视口时加载,显著提升首屏速度。

2. 精简与优化代码

高效的代码是快速加载的基石。

  • 文件压缩:移除CSS、JavaScript和HTML文件中的空格、注释和未使用的代码,并进行压缩(Minify)。
  • 减少HTTP请求:合并多个CSS或JS文件,利用CSS Sprites技术合并小图标,以降低请求次数。
  • 使用语义化HTML标签:合理使用
    等标签,有助于浏览器更快地解析页面结构。

3. 利用浏览器缓存与CDN加速

缓存和CDN是提升重复访问和地理访问速度的利器。

  • 配置浏览器缓存:通过设置HTTP响应头(如Cache-Control),让静态资源(如图片、CSS、JS)在用户本地缓存,下次访问时直接加载本地副本。
  • 启用内容分发网络(CDN):将静态资源分发到全球各地的边缘服务器,用户可从最近的节点获取数据,大幅减少网络延迟。

4. 服务器与后端优化

强大的后端支持是前端流畅体验的保障。

  • 升级服务器配置:根据网站流量适时提升服务器CPU、内存和带宽。
  • 启用Gzip/Brotli压缩:在服务器端对文本资源进行压缩传输,可减少约70%的体积。
  • 数据库优化:为数据库查询字段建立索引,清理冗余数据,优化SQL语句,减少查询时间。
  • 启用HTTP/2或HTTP/3协议:这些新协议支持多路复用,能显著减少连接建立时间,提升传输效率。

5. 核心Web指标与渲染优化

关注用户体验相关的核心性能指标。

  • 优先加载关键内容:提取首屏渲染所必需的关键CSS并内联,延迟加载非关键JavaScript,避免渲染阻塞。
  • 考虑服务端渲染(SSR):对于动态内容丰富的网站,采用SSR技术可以直接向浏览器返回渲染好的HTML,加快首屏显示。

三、持续监测与维护

网站优化不是一劳永逸的。应定期使用性能检测工具(如Google Lighthouse、WebPageTest)进行审计,监控首屏加载时间、最大内容绘制(LCP)、首次输入延迟(FID)等关键指标,及时发现并解决性能回退问题。

点评:网站速度优化是一项涉及前端、后端、网络及资源的系统工程。本文从诊断、优化到维护,提供了一套完整的解决方案,涵盖了从图片压缩、代码精简到服务器升级、CDN加速等关键措施。遵循这些步骤,不仅能显著提升用户体验,降低跳出率,更能迎合搜索引擎的排名偏好,为网站的长远发展奠定坚实的技术基础。

本文链接:http://queautocompro.com/Article/details/D9QLeX.html

相关应用

智能助手
智能游戏助手 ×
您好!我是好奇心日报的智能助手,您可以问我关于“网站打开速度慢怎么优化”的攻略。